Imphal: Manipur Chief Minister N Biren Singh paid tributes to Netaji Subhas Chandra Bose on Parakram Diwas.

N Biren said on a social network site, “Humble tributes to India’s great freedom fighter, Netaji Subhas Chandra Bose on the occasion of Parakram Diwas.”

He added, “The INA headquarters at Moirang in Bishnupur district, Manipur, where the INA unfurled the tricolor flag for the first time on April 14, 1944, was set up by Netaji himself. On his 126th birth anniversary, let us reaffirm our pledge to serve the nation and work for its progress and development.”
